Kegg module M00529 is descriptive of Denitrification, nitrate => nitrogen module, which is part of the Energy metabolism category and Nitrogen metabolism subcategory.

Id Description
K00368 nitrite reductase (NO-forming) [EC:1.7.2.1]
K00370 nitrate reductase / nitrite oxidoreductase, alpha subunit [EC:1.7.5.1 1.7.99.-]
K00371 nitrate reductase / nitrite oxidoreductase, beta subunit [EC:1.7.5.1 1.7.99.-]
K00374 nitrate reductase gamma subunit [EC:1.7.5.1 1.7.99.-]
K00376 nitrous-oxide reductase [EC:1.7.2.4]
K02305 nitric oxide reductase subunit C
K02567 nitrate reductase (cytochrome) [EC:1.9.6.1]
K02568 nitrate reductase (cytochrome), electron transfer subunit
K04561 nitric oxide reductase subunit B [EC:1.7.2.5]
K15864 nitrite reductase (NO-forming) / hydroxylamine reductase [EC:1.7.2.1 1.7.99.1]
